A three number MOS shows a warrant officer. And AG warrants are 420's.Smirnoff171 wrote:Ranger UNATAINABLE E5,
42A is Human Resources Specialist.
I believe 142A is an HR officer...or something like that.
The Regiment posted a pic of the 75th S1 on the HR forums on AKO....
and they weren't lying when they said that 42A's are so rare that they really do put grunts in the position.
AG commissioned officer's are 42B's.
